This was the third boat adrift today. A St Johns wide beam boat had passed us a while back. In fact Ian mentioned that it was going a little fast. We had to hang back to let it pass some moored boats and as we got level with them, Ian notice that his front pin had been pulled. We passed with no mishap and a couple walking their dog managed to bring it back to the side. So we were not at all surprised to spy this boat across the cut. Not just this one but a small cruiser also drifting about without his mooring pins. Ian did the gentlemanly thing and went to sort it out. A lady from another boat came to help him and eventually the boat was secured and we went on our way.
